Grat"u*late (?), v. t. [imp. & p. p. Grqatulated (?); p. pr. & vb. n. Gratulating (?).] [L. gratulatus, p. p. of gratulari to congratulate, fr. gratus pleasing, agreeable. See Grate, a.]

To salute with declaration of joy; to congratulate.

[R.]

Shak.

Grat"u*late (?), a.

Worthy of gratulation.

[Obs.]

There's more behind that is more gratulate. Shak.
